How they compare
ESCAP: East and North-east Asia (enea) (unsdcode:98408) currently reports 1.58 % change on previous year against 1.12 % change on previous year in Georgia, a difference of 0.46 % change on previous year.
That makes ESCAP: East and North-east Asia (enea) (unsdcode:98408)'s figure about 1.4 times Georgia's.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 24 shared years of data; in 1992 it was ESCAP: East and North-east Asia (enea) (unsdcode:98408) ahead.
ESCAP: East and North-east Asia (enea) (unsdcode:98408) ranks 100th and Georgia ranks 100th of 221 groups.
ESCAP: East and North-east Asia (enea) (unsdcode:98408) has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Teachers in primary education, female (number).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
